Roof Window Replacement Questions
What types of roof windows are available for replacement? Common options include skylights, roof lanterns, and Velux-style windows, each suited for different roof types and lighting needs.
How can I tell if my roof window needs replacing? Signs include leaks, drafts, difficulty opening, or visible damage to the window or surrounding roof area.
What should property owners consider before replacing a roof window? It's important to evaluate compatibility with the roof structure, insulation needs, and the desired amount of natural light.
Are there any specific roof types that are better suited for roof window replacement? Flat and pitched roofs can both accommodate roof windows, but the installation process varies based on roof design and material.
